Comparative Analysis of A* And Basic Theta* Algorithm In Android-Based Pathfinding Games

被引:0
|
作者
Firmansyah, Eka Risky [1 ]
Masruroh, Siti Ummi [1 ]
Fahrianto, Feri [1 ]
机构
[1] Syarif Hidayatullah State Islamic Univ, Jakarta, Indonesia
关键词
Comparison Algorithm; Search Algorithm; A* (A Star); Basic Theta* (Basic Theta Star); Pathfinding Games;
D O I
10.1109/ICT4M.2016.56
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Pathfinding games is a kind of mobile games which are included in Puzzle, Board Game, Game Show, Trivia, Card Games. Pathfinding games require a search techniques to get the fastest route, efficient, and shortest time. Searching techniques that can be used are A* (A Star) and Basic Theta* (Basic Theta Star) algorithm. A* algorithm was originally introduced by Peter Hart et al., A* algorithm calculate the cost using a heuristic function to prioritize the nodes (vertex) to be traversed, the cost is the distance it takes to walk from a node to anothernode. Basic Theta* algorithm is a variant of the A* made by Alex Nash et al. in 2007 because A* has the disadvantage that the results route is often not true shortest path because the routing path is limited by the grid, while the Basic Theta* change the limit of routing path becomes to all sides/angles. In this study will measure the performance of search methods which is better for square grids map on Android-based pathfinding games and used variable such as completeness, time complexity, and optimality. Input parameters for the simulation consists of a square-grids map with a starting point, goal point and unwalkable, and output consists of completeness, running time, path length, and nodes searched. The results of this study conclude that the A* and Basic Theta*algorithm has the same completeness criteria and has time complexity which is relatively same, the A* algorithm has the advantage of optimality in fewer number of nodes searched, whereas the Basic Theta*algorithm has the advantage of the optimality the shortest results.
引用
收藏
页码:275 / 280
页数:6
相关论文
共 50 条
  • [1] Android-based games to detect history of radicalism
    Rodli, Achmad Fathoni
    Boeriswati, Endry
    Prasnowo, M. Adhi
    Pamungkas, Djauhari
    Nirwanasari, Renny
    [J]. 1ST INTERNATIONAL CONFERENCE ON ADVANCE AND SCIENTIFIC INNOVATION, 2019, 1175
  • [2] Application of Collision Detection Algorithm and Scoring Health Point in Fighting Games with Android-Based Augmented Reality Technology
    Rachman, Andi Nur
    Shofa, Rahmi Nur
    Dewi, Euis Nur Fitriani
    Hidayat, Aldi
    [J]. 2019 2ND INTERNATIONAL CONFERENCE OF COMPUTER AND INFORMATICS ENGINEERING (IC2IE 2019): ARTIFICIAL INTELLIGENCE ROLES IN INDUSTRIAL REVOLUTION 4.0, 2019, : 216 - 221
  • [3] Identification of Android-Based Interactive Multimedia Needs for Basic Physics Content
    Ma'ruf, M.
    Setiawan, A.
    Suhandi, A.
    [J]. 2ND INTERNATIONAL CONFERENCE ON SCIENCE, MATHEMATICS, ENVIRONMENT, AND EDUCATION, 2019, 2019, 2194
  • [4] Comparative Study of Android-Based M-Apps for Farmers
    Kaur, Sukhpreet
    Dhindsa, Kanwalvir Singh
    [J]. INTERNATIONAL CONFERENCE ON INTELLIGENT COMPUTING AND APPLICATIONS, ICICA 2016, 2018, 632 : 173 - 183
  • [5] Android-Based Mathematics Learning Games That are Interesting for Junior High School Students
    Qohar, A.
    Susiswo
    Nasution, S. H.
    Adem, A. M. G.
    [J]. 2ND ANNUAL INTERNATIONAL CONFERENCE ON MATHEMATICS AND SCIENCE EDUCATION, 2019, 1227
  • [6] Forensic Analysis of Android-based Instant Messaging Application
    Riadi, Imam
    Firdonsyah, Arizona
    [J]. 2018 12TH INTERNATIONAL CONFERENCE ON TELECOMMUNICATION SYSTEMS, SERVICES, AND APPLICATIONS (TSSA), 2018,
  • [7] Security Analysis of Cryptocurrency Wallets in Android-Based Applications
    He, Daojing
    Li, Shihao
    Li, Cong
    Zhu, Sencun
    Chan, Sammy
    Min, Weidong
    Guizani, Nadra
    [J]. IEEE NETWORK, 2020, 34 (06): : 114 - 119
  • [8] Reliability and Validity of Gait Analysis by Android-Based Smartphone
    Nishiguchi, Shu
    Yamada, Minoru
    Nagai, Koutatsu
    Mori, Shuhei
    Kajiwara, Yuu
    Sonoda, Takuya
    Yoshimura, Kazuya
    Yoshitomi, Hiroyuki
    Ito, Hiromu
    Okamoto, Kazuya
    Ito, Tatsuaki
    Muto, Shinyo
    Ishihara, Tatsuya
    Aoyama, Tomoki
    [J]. TELEMEDICINE AND E-HEALTH, 2012, 18 (04) : 292 - 296
  • [9] Developing an Android-Based City Tour App using Evolutionary Algorithm
    Izzah, Abidatul
    Kusuma, Irmala A.
    Irawan, Yudi
    Cinderatama, Toga A.
    [J]. International Journal of Interactive Mobile Technologies, 2021, 15 (14) : 193 - 203
  • [10] The Development of Android-Based Statistical Application for Taekwondo Match Analysis
    Al Ardha, Muchamad Arif
    Nurhasan, Nurhasan
    Ristanto, Kolektus Oky
    Wijaya, Andhega
    Java, Muhammad Iskandar
    Bikalawan, Sauqi Sawa
    Putra, Kukuh Pambuka
    Yang, Chung Bing
    [J]. TEM JOURNAL-TECHNOLOGY EDUCATION MANAGEMENT INFORMATICS, 2024, 13 (02): : 1702 - 1707